## Understanding Anthropology and Its Branches

Sociology is frequently called the holistic research of mankind. It seeks to comprehend individuals not equally as isolated individuals but as part of interconnected social, organic, and historical systems. To do this, anthropologists typically function across four main subfields:

1. ** Social Anthropology **: This branch concentrates on comprehending modern human cultures– their customs, social standards, rituals, and establishments. Cultural anthropologists submerse themselves in areas, carrying out ethnographic study to capture the lived experiences of people.

2. ** Archaeology **: Excavators check out past human societies with product continues to be such as artifacts, structures, and landscapes. By examining these residues, they rebuild historic ways of life and discover just how cultures progressed with time.

3. ** Biological or Physical Anthropology **: This location analyzes people as biological organisms. It includes the research of human advancement, genetics, primatology, and forensic evaluation, helping to trace exactly how human beings have adapted literally to altering environments.

4. ** Linguistic Sociology **: Language is a core component of culture, and linguistic anthropologists examine the means language shapes social life, identity, and power characteristics. ## Fieldwork: The Foundation of Anthropological Study

Fieldwork is one of one of the most unique aspects of sociology. Unlike disciplines that count solely on research laboratory experiments or historical study, anthropologists commonly immerse themselves in the atmospheres they research. This hands-on approach permits a much deeper understanding of human actions and social characteristics.

For social anthropologists, fieldwork might involve living in a country village for months to observe day-to-day regimens, rituals, and social interactions. Archaeologists may spend years digging deep into a single website, carefully cataloging artifacts to reconstruct the lives of ancient peoples. Organic anthropologists could study populations in varied environmental setups, checking out exactly how environmental pressures influence physiology and habits.

Fieldwork calls for persistence, versatility, and cultural level of sensitivity. Anthropologists need to construct count on within areas, browse honest factors to consider, and usually confront difficulties varying from severe environmental problems to complex political or social dynamics. Yet, it is this immersive technique that makes it possible for anthropologists to produce authentic, nuanced understandings right into human life.

## Principles and Responsibility in Sociology

Sociology is inherently joint and deeply honest. Anthropologists collaborate with human subjects, frequently from at risk or marginalized communities, and their research can have long lasting social implications. Ethical method involves obtaining educated consent, appreciating privacy, and guaranteeing that research benefits– not exploits– participants.

Several anthropologists additionally take part in campaigning for, using their understanding to support neighborhood objectives or address social oppressions. For instance, anthropological research study has actually educated public health treatments, aided protect endangered languages, and affected policy choices pertaining to social heritage and aboriginal rights.

Principles in anthropology encompasses just how findings are translated and shared. Anthropologists make every effort to existing societies precisely and pleasantly, staying clear of stereotypes or simple generalizations. This responsibility highlights the broader societal significance of the area: anthropology is not almost comprehending mankind but likewise concerning fostering empathy and cross-cultural awareness.

## Sociology and Comprehending Human Variety

At its core, sociology has to do with recognizing difference and commonness. Anthropologists study exactly how societies organize themselves, how individuals express identity, and how cultural practices adjust over time. This focus on diversity assists combat ethnocentrism– the propensity to evaluate various other societies by one’s own criteria– and promotes a more inclusive worldview.

As an example, research on kinship systems, gender functions, or financial techniques exposes that there is no solitary “right” method to arrange culture. Anthropologists demonstrate how context shapes norms, worths, and behavior, testing presumptions and increasing perspectives.

In a progressively interconnected globe, this understanding is indispensable. Anthropological research study informs diplomacy, international growth, and worldwide participation by promoting mutual understanding throughout social boundaries.

## Obstacles and Advancing Frontiers

The practice of anthropology deals with ongoing difficulties. Globalization, political instability, environment modification, and technological makeover create new research study contexts and honest dilemmas. Anthropologists should browse these complexities while preserving methodological rigor and cultural sensitivity.

Arising locations of passion consist of digital sociology, which checks out human habits in online spaces; medical sociology, which discovers the social dimensions of wellness and ailment; and urban anthropology, which researches the characteristics of rapidly expanding cities.

Technical advances such as remote picking up, 3D modeling, and hereditary evaluation are increasing the tools available to anthropologists, enabling extra exact and all natural study than in the past.
